(2S)-2-[(Ethylthio)carbonyl]-5-oxo-1-pyrrolidinecarboxylic Acid tert-Butyl Ester is an organic compound that serves as an intermediate in the synthesis of various pharmaceutical compounds. It is characterized by its clear oil appearance and plays a crucial role in the preparation of rac-Vigabatrin Hydrochloride (V253010), (-)-Sessilifoliamide C, and (-)-8-Epi-stemoamide.

1298023-90-1 Usage

Uses

Used in Pharmaceutical Industry:
(2S)-2-[(Ethylthio)carbonyl]-5-oxo-1-pyrrolidinecarboxylic Acid tert-Butyl Ester is used as a key intermediate in the synthesis of various pharmaceutical compounds for the development of new drugs. Its application is essential in the preparation of rac-Vigabatrin Hydrochloride (V253010), which is an antiepileptic drug used to treat seizures in infants and children. Additionally, it is involved in the synthesis of (-)-Sessilifoliamide C and (-)-8-Epi-stemoamide, which are potential therapeutic agents with various biological activities.

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 1298023-90-1 includes 10 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 7 digits, 1,2,9,8,0,2 and 3 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 9 and 0 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 1298023-90:
(9*1)+(8*2)+(7*9)+(6*8)+(5*0)+(4*2)+(3*3)+(2*9)+(1*0)=171
171 % 10 = 1
So 1298023-90-1 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Formal synthesis of (-)-oseltamivir phosphate

Trajkovic, Milos,Ferjancic, Zorana,Saicic, Radomir N.

, p. 389 - 395 (2013/03/28)

The formal synthesis of (-)-oseltamivir phosphate (Tamiflutm) was accomplished starting from (S)-pyroglutamic acid. The synthesis comprised two carbon-carbon bond forming reactions, the first one being a diastereoselective, indium-mediated allylation of a pyroglutamic aldehyde derivative. However, attempts to effect the second carbon-carbon bond formation - cyclohexene ring closure - using an enol-exo aldolization of a dialdehyde resulted in the formation of a product with the opposite regioselectivity. This shortcoming could be overcome by using a reaction sequence of Mannich methylenation/ring-closing metathesis, which provided the desired regioisomer in high yield. Total synthesis of (-)-sessilifoliamide C and (-)-8-epi-stemoamide

Hoye, Adam T.,Wipf, Peter

, p. 2634 - 2637 (2011/07/09)

A convergent route featuring [3,3]-sigmatropic rearrangements of a linchpin azepinopyrrolidine served to install two of the four contiguous stereocenters present in the tricyclic Stemona alkaloids sessilifoliamide and stemoamide. In addition to the first total synthesis of (-)-sessilifoliamide C, a potential biosynthetic relationship between the sessilifoliamides and previously reported Stemona alkaloids is presented.
